Macedonian AF mission to Bosnia extended for six months

03. januar 2008. | Igor Božinovski

On January 3rd, Macedonian Parliament adopted a decision to expand for another six months Macedonian Army participation to European Union's operation ALTHEA in Bosnia and Herzegovina. This will be the fourth rotation in Bosnia and Herzegovina where Macedonian Air Force has a helicopter detachment composed of two Mi-8/17 helicopters deployed since July 14th, 2006. The first rotation included a 17-strong unit (July-December 2006), the second a staff of 21 (January-June 2007), which was the same number of people in the third rotation (July-December 2007). Macedonian Helicopter Detachment was initially based at Mostar-Ortjes air base but relocated during the second rotation to Sarajevo-Butmir air base where it is now based. Unlike the first three rotations that have helicopter detachment composed of two Mi-8/17 helicopters, the ongoing fourth contingent will be composed of only one Mi-8/17 helicopter. Operation ALTHEA is the first EU-led crisis management operation in which Macedonia is participating and is in fact first strong express of Macedonian support to the European Security and Defense Policy (ESDP) after the EU has granted Macedonia candidate-member status in December 2005.
